COLUMBUS, OH, May 09, 2011 (Press-News.org) TechConnect Ohio is proud to announce the current list of sponsor companies who will be in attendance for its inaugural event aimed at connecting job seekers with companies looking to fill open positions with the local technical talent.
"Ohio-based companies are committed to seeking out local technical talent. There is no better way to bring companies and talent together than attending the TechConnect event," said Dan Harris, VP of Strategy at Minds On and the originator of the TechConnect Ohio concept.
TechConnect Ohio is please to have the following companies commit their time and resources to this event: TDCI, Manta, Fast Switch, Northwoods Consulting Partners, Oxford Consulting, Halcyon Solutions, Nationwide Insurance, Worthpoint, Chase, Huntington Bank, Ecommerce Advanced Services, BPL Global, Limited Brands, Fiserv, 2Checkout, Thirty-One Gifts, BMW Financial Services, NetJets, Motorist Mutual Insurance Company, Bridgeline Digital, BAAX, and SiSware.

Columbus State Community College, Devy, and Ohio Wesleyan Universities will also be on-site connecting companies with their intern programs and recent graduates.
In addition to networking with hiring companies, Worthington Career Services will be providing free resume reviews and interviewing skills workshops to help job seekers fine tune their resumes and skills.
This event takes place on Thursday, May 12th 2011 from 12 noon to 6pm at the Conference Center at OCLC at 6600 Kilgour Place in Dublin, Ohio. The cost to attend is $10.00. TechConnect Ohio is an organization connecting Ohio companies with tech professionals, graduates and interns in engineering, mathematics, IT, and software development using a unique fast pitch, networking event. For further information contact us at (740) 417-0500. http://www.techconnectohio.com
